Who is Ben McKenzie?
Benjamin McKenzie Schenkkan, known professionally as Ben McKenzie, is an American actor, director, writer, and commentator. He is famous for playing Ryan Atwood on The O.C., Officer Ben Sherman on Southland, and James Gordon on Gotham.
He is not only a television star but also a stage actor, film performer, and now a published author. In 2023, he co-authored Easy Money, a book exposing fraud in the world of cryptocurrency. This mix of entertainment and finance makes his career unique.
Early Life
Ben McKenzie was born on September 12, 1978, in Austin, Texas. His mother, Frances, is a poet, and his father, Pieter, works as an attorney. He grew up with two brothers, Nate and Zack.
His family is filled with creativity and intellect. His uncle, Robert Schenkkan, is a Pulitzer Prize-winning playwright. His grandfather, Robert F. Schenkkan, was involved in shaping American public broadcasting. Even his cousin, Sarah Drew, is an actress.
Ben’s middle name, McKenzie, comes from his grandmother’s maiden name, which he adopted to avoid confusion with another actor named Ben Shenkman.

Education
Ben attended St. Andrew’s Episcopal School in Austin, where he was a classmate and football teammate of future NFL legend Drew Brees. He then moved on to Stephen F. Austin High School, where he played wide receiver and defensive back.
After graduating in 1997, Ben enrolled at the University of Virginia, a school tied to his family tradition. He studied economics and foreign affairs and completed his degree in 2001. His education in economics later influenced his deep interest in financial systems and cryptocurrency.

Ben Mckenzie Career Highlights

Breakthrough with The O.C. (2003–2007)
Ben’s career changed when he landed the role of Ryan Atwood in The O.C.. The teen drama became an international hit. Reports suggest he earned $15,000 to $25,000 per episode. The series made him a household name and one of the most recognized young actors of the early 2000s.
Southland and Critical Success (2009–2013)
After The O.C., he took on the gritty role of Officer Ben Sherman in Southland. The crime drama gained critical praise for its realistic storytelling. His performance showcased his depth as an actor beyond teenage drama roles.
Gotham (2014–2019)
His role as Detective James Gordon in Gotham was another major milestone. He appeared in all 100 episodes, directed three, and wrote two. This project not only added to Ben McKenzie net worth but also gave him a reputation as a versatile talent in Hollywood.
Stage and New Work (2019–Present)
He made his Broadway debut in 2020 with Grand Horizons. In recent years, he has also worked on film projects like Line of Duty (2019) and is set to release a documentary on cryptocurrency in 2025.
Criticism of Cryptocurrency
Since 2021, Ben McKenzie has become one of the few celebrities openly critical of cryptocurrency. His economics background helped him analyze the risks behind crypto and NFTs.
In 2023, he co-authored Easy Money: Cryptocurrency, Casino Capitalism, and the Golden Age of Fraud with journalist Jacob Silverman. He even testified before the U.S. Senate about the harms of the crypto bubble and spoke at events like SXSW and Web Summit.
This work added a new layer to his identity—an actor who also speaks out about financial issues.

Relationship
Ben McKenzie began dating actress Morena Baccarin in 2015, his co-star from Gotham. The couple’s relationship became public when legal documents during Baccarin’s divorce revealed she was expecting Ben’s child.
They welcomed their daughter, Frances, in 2016 and married on June 2, 2017, which was also Morena’s birthday. In March 2021, they had a son, and Ben also became stepfather to Morena’s older son, Julius.
Their marriage is often described as supportive, balancing their family life with busy careers.
